A Colombian national charged with unlawful importation of illicit drugs was yesterday remanded by the High Court in Suva.
Aiden Alec Hurtado is alleged to have imported 20.5 kilograms of cocaine into Fiji without lawful authority in 2014.
Justice Achala Wengappuli has ordered corrections to take Hurtado to the Colonial War Memorial Hospital for medical treatment.
Hurtado’s trial date has been set for May 22 to June 9 next year.
The case has been adjourned to December 14 for mention.
